你查询的IP:[119.128.127.20]  地理位置:中国–广东–东莞

最新查询120.94.221.235 124.42.235.126 218.108.173.75 123.64.136.219 121.46.2.129 121.201.67.105 116.112.133.13 202.112.135.3 124.67.244.68 119.128.127.20 222.176.0.216 203.223.125.224 116.56.225.86 123.184.39.138 222.168.214.113 202.165.208.101 210.2.178.176 124.172.237.94 202.179.240.238 210.32.91.87 123.196.195.255 119.161.128.83 119.40.77.223 203.208.32.104 125.214.96.15 121.101.208.171 134.196.85.51 122.112.64.254 210.5.144.120 202.127.224.118 118.112.214.54